SCREEN WIDTH
Our website is also optimized for a display width of 1024, which means that the page is 1,024 pixels across.  (A pixel is a small square of light that makes up a computer monitor).  To see if your monitor is large enough (in Windows) simply right click on the desktop and select Properties.  Go to the "Settings" tab and you will see a portion called "Resolution" with a sliding arrow that you can move from "less" to "more."  This tells you how many pixels your monitor is displaying and how many it can display.  Drag the arrow until you see 1024 (or above) and you are now optimized to see our website at its finest.
